Publisher's Synopsis

This is a book discussing the present state of the art of avionic systems in a manner intelligible to both the student and the technician.;Avionics was a major factor in preserving the world from Nazi domination in the 1940s. It was only in 1935 that Dr Watson Watt's team carried out the famous experiment at the BBC's Daventry transmitter and received a signal reflected back from a Heyford bomber approaching Daventry.;The 50 years since this event have seen scientists and engineers at research centres and manufacturer's works combine computer technology with developments in this field to produce systems of unbelievable capability and reliability.
